We are creating a new organization with the aim to put a well-defined and standardized global Customs &Import operating model in place across all relevant dimensions, from compliance, customer service, operational efficiency to leveraging free-trade agreements and customs costs.
We are now looking for a professional Senior Customs Expert who will perform execution of continuous improvement for all processes associated with import /export and ensure end-to-end daily activities defined into Customs RACI and compliance with country rules and regulations. You will work directly with regional and local teams with operational/tactical customs activities (import and export flow) and provide stakeholders with customs and trade solutions.
The position holder will be main responsible for the Annex 24 & 30 and virtual operations assuring full compliance with laws, norms, Government programs requirements such as AEO, IMMEX, PROSEC and VAT-IMMEX. As well as non-tariff restrictions, Importer registry, Free Trade Agreements and logistics' regulations guarantying the different legal compliance affairs of the international trade operations at Tetra Pak Mexico.
The location for this position is Queretaro, Mexico and this is a permanent position.

What you will do

As Senior Customs Expert, you will:

  • Manage and assure compliance of Immex and Annex 24.
  • Recording import and export transactions
  • Registration of destruction certificates/records
  • Processing and tracking of customs regime changes of scrap or others
  • Validation of part number catalogs and Bills of Materials (BOMs) between ZOE system and SAP
  • Inventory reconciliation
  • Data comparison and validation against DataStage reports
  • Analyze balance and backflush reports
  • Drive operational performance of import, export and transit activities
  • BEX and support with the system ZOE
  • Virtual operations support
  • Participate in Audits answers and contact with the authorities to ensure compliance
  • Answer queries and provide support to stakeholders engaged in cross-border activities
  • Drive Operational interactions with brokers/3rd parties
  • Identify potential optimization regarding operating costs and opportunities for reducing customs duty spending
  • Ensure end-to-end daily activities defined into Customs roles & responsibilities matrix and compliance with country rules and regulations
  • Ensure compliance under the Authorized Economic Operator authorization, Inward processing and Outward processing regimes
  • Execution of continuous improvement for all processes
  • Continuously monitor relevant Key Performance Indicators (KPIs) with partners
  • Streamline customs operations processes where possible
  • Proactively avoid or mitigate any potential business continuity or economic risk related to Tetra Pak operational structure and its customs transactions
  • Ensure the correct Tariff classification of goods imported and exported
  • Monitor changes and translate laws & regulations into executable rules, directions and guidelines and integrate them into day-to-day operations, either for Imports, Export, Virtual or any customs transaction or program, registry, or license obligation.
  • Identify and address knowledge gaps through training and knowledge sharing.
  • Manage Benefits such as IMMEX/CIVA. Annex 24.
  • Export compliance.

About Tetra Pak

We’re here to make food safe and available. It’s why we provide advanced food production systems, from product creation and recipe testing to processing, filling, packaging, logistics, services and beyond. We support almost every food and beverage category with tailored solutions for category-specific needs.

In collaboration with our customers and suppliers, driven by more than 24,000 dedicated employees worldwide, we protect food sustainably every day for hundreds of millions of people in more than 160 countries. Because we’re here to fulfil a purpose:
